One of our automotive clients in Woodbridge, ON is looking for a Robot Technician for their facility.
Shift - Day shift
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Sets up robotic stations by operating/retrieving various computer programs stored in robotic equipment.
Able to maintain equipment and follow procedures when trouble-shooting for equipment related to the Continual Improvement projects.
Inspects all machinery for defects and potential problems in accordance with preventative maintenance program; repairs and replaces parts as required.
Operates robotic equipment to achieve desired results.
Completes equipment calibrations / capabilities.
- Knowledge of PLC logic/programming.
Uses a thorough understanding of hydraulics, pneumatics and mechanical systems to ensure proper operation of the equipment..
Completion of Mechanical Preventive Maintenance requirements
Follows the Preventive Maintenance Instruction properly.
Notifies the Maintenance Supervisor of any problems encountered and the possible solutions.
Completes the work order properly and returns it to the Maintenance Technical Assistant promptly.
Coaches all team members on areas of specialized knowledge.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Must possess an Electromechanical Engineering Technician / Technologist Diploma.
Must have experience with automated lines and pallet conveyor system.
Knowledge of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) and communications to Robot controls.
Must have excellent planning and time managing skills and able to produce quality work efficiently.
Extensive knowledge programming and trouble shooting Fanuc robots.
